✈️ Boeing 737NG First Officer (Type‑Rated)

Take the next step in your flight deck career with a permanent opportunity on the Boeing 737 Next Generation. We’re seeking a proven, type-rated First Officer who brings precision, professionalism, and great crew resource management to every sector.

  • Employment: Permanent
  • Aircraft: Boeing 737NG (Type-Rated)
  • License: ATPL — open to EASA holders
  • Medical: Class 1
  • Languages: English, Ukrainian
  • ICAO ELP: Level 4
  • Visa sponsorship: Provided
  • Additional requirement: Clean criminal record

🧭 The Role

As a Boeing 737NG First Officer, you will fly short- and medium-haul operations alongside an experienced Captain, delivering safe, efficient, and passenger-focused journeys from briefing to block-in.

  • Execute all phases of flight in accordance with SOPs, regulatory standards, and company policies.
  • Apply robust threat and error management, fuel-efficient techniques, and sound decision-making.
  • Demonstrate strong CRM, communication, and leadership-in-support across a multicultural cockpit.
  • Maintain currency, technical proficiency, and a continuous improvement mindset.

🧰 Minimum Requirements

  • Total time: Minimum 1,500 hours (excluding P3 time, rotary, and single/multi‑engine piston)
  • On type: Minimum 500 hours on B737NG
  • Type rating: Current B737NG type rating required
  • Recent experience: At least 150 hours on type within the last 12 months at time of joining
  • License: Valid ATPLEASA
  • Medical: Valid Class 1
  • English proficiency: ICAO ELP Level 4 or higher
  • Languages: Proficient in English and Ukrainian
  • Compliance: Clean criminal record
